The cheapest way to get from Calgary to Paris is to fly which costs €280 - €700 and takes 11h 45m.
The fastest way to get from Calgary to Paris is to fly which takes 11h 45m and costs €280 - €700.
The distance between Calgary and Paris is 7407 km.
It takes approximately 11h 45m to get from Calgary to Paris, including transfers.
Paris is 8h ahead of Calgary. It is currently 2:32 PM in Calgary and 10:32 PM in Paris.
